With record-breaking snowfall in some areas\u2014like Rhode Island, which was buried under more than 3 feet of snow\u2014this storm has left thousands without power, canceled flights, and turned cities into winter wonderlands that are anything but magical. But the region&#8217;s troubles may not be over, as forecasters warn another storm could be on its way, threatening to pile on the misery.<\/p>\n<p>      Why it matters<\/p>\n<p>This storm has exposed the region&#8217;s vulnerability to extreme winter weather, raising questions about whether cities like New York and Philadelphia should prioritize public safety over quickly reopening schools and businesses during such events. The debate over balancing safety and a return to normalcy is far from over.<\/p>\n<p>            The details<\/p>\n<p>By Tuesday, the region began to dig out, thanks to heroic efforts from neighbors, government crews, and even a snow-clearing machine nicknamed Darth Vader. Roads started to reopen, power was restored to some of the hundreds of thousands affected, and mass transit systems sputtered back to life. Yet, the debate raged on: Should schools reopen? In New York City, Mayor Zohran Mamdani declared schools would resume in-person learning, sparking controversy.
